How To Select the Right Fiberglass Insulation for Your Attic

Selecting the proper fiberglass insulation for your attic is essential to ensure that you get the most out of your insulation. When making your selection, there are a few factors to consider, including the climate you live in, the type of home you have, and how much insulation you currently have. The following article will discuss the factors in detail:

1. Consider the Climate You Live In

When selecting any brand or type of fiberglass insulation for your attic, for instance, Owens Corning Jacksonville Florida-based, it is vital to consider your climate in that particular area. If the area experiences cold winters and hot summers, you will want to choose insulation that can withstand extreme temperatures.

2. Choose the Proper R-Value

You will want to choose insulation with an R-value of at least R-30 for your attic. The R-value of insulation measures its ability to resist heat flow. The higher the R-value, the better the insulation will be at resisting heat flow.

3. Consider the Type of Home You Have

The kind of home you have will also play a role in the kind of insulation you select. If you have a newer home, you may want to choose insulation with a higher R-value. On the other hand, older homes may not need as much insulation since they are already well insulated.

4. Consider the Amount of Insulation You Currently Have

If you already have a significant amount of insulation in your attic, you may not need to add more. In this case, you can purchase insulation with the same R-value as the insulation you already have.

You can make your ceilings appear higher by following two simple tips. You can put a lengthy floor lamp in the room or install striped wall paper. Additions like these mean optical illusions that people’s eyes can trace upward. Your eyes will then think the ceilings are higher in height than they really are.

A lot of houses may lose around one fifth of the cold or heat through a clear glass window. By glazing your large, picture windows, you can significantly cut back on the loss of heat and cold air. Your home will be more comfortable inside, and your energy bills will decrease.

Cool and Healthy Home Without AC

Cool and Healthy Home Without AC

With the right planning, you can create a cool, comfortable, and healthy home even without air conditioning or air conditioning. How to?

Cool and Healthy Home Without AC

In tropical countries like Indonesia, the intensity of sunlight is sometimes excessive, especially entering the dry season. As a result, the house becomes hot and stifling. For that, you must know how to make your house cool and healthy , even without air conditioning or air conditioning.

Air conditioning can indeed be an instant solution , but you have to be prepared to spend more money on electricity costs. Moreover, electricity rates often go up.

Actually, with proper planning, the house can be made cool, comfortable, and healthy even without air conditioning. How, by looking at the movement of sunlight.

Cool Bedroom

Besides being good for health, the morning sunlight that enters the bedroom makes you not lazy to wake up. So that the morning sun can enter this space, place the bedroom on the southeast to northeast side. This position also prevents the bedroom from being blocked from the afternoon sun which often makes the room hot at night.

Cool Public

Public spaces Family rooms, living rooms, and dining rooms should be on the northwest or southwest side. In this position, public spaces will get warm natural lighting.

However, to reduce solar heat from the west side, it is necessary to use heat-absorbing materials. You can use a coating for the walls or install aluminum foil on the ceiling of the house.

Also make cross ventilation (cross ventilation) by making lots of vents on the two opposite sides of the wall. This method is proven to be effective in bringing coolness in the room.

Bathroom

The bathroom or toilet has high humidity. A humid room is very dangerous for health, especially breathing.

In order to reduce humidity levels, the bathroom or toilet really needs direct sunlight. For that, place the bathroom on the west or east side of the house.

Kitchen

As a place to cook, the kitchen has a high room temperature. Therefore, the kitchen should be placed in a position that gets less sunlight, namely on the north or south side of the house.

Opening the house

To reduce exposure to direct sunlight, place the opening of the house, such as a door or window on the north or south side. If this is not possible, you can install curtains or heat-absorbing glass on the door or window .…
